Zeolite catalyst or shape selective catalyst:
Zeolites are small porous alumina silicates. Their general formula is M3 [(Al2O3)x (SiO2)y]3 n H2O where n is the oxidation state of metal (M).
Example:
Zeolite catalyst ZSM-5 is used in the conversion of alcohol into petrol (gasoline). The dehydration of alcohol takes place on pores of zeolite and forms a mixture of hydrocarbons.
